"Brake Block Off Plate"
I see that some people have listed this in their mod section and I am curious.....
What does this mean and what does it do?
Sorry, another darn Newbie question! What benefits does it have?

Eliminates the parking brake assembly, which is very prone to dragging, and wearing out your brake pads prematurely. Simple, low cost fix, and it eliminates some pieces most of us never use. I know it is the same with the 300ex and 400ex, but I haven't seen a 250ex to know if it's the same or not.

It's a small plate that covers the hole left on the backside of your rear brake caliper when you remove the paring brake assy..this eliminates some usless hardware, and allows you to get a aftermarket clutch perch as well.
